About S. Nijalingappa Medical College & HSK Hospital & Research Centre, Bagalkot
S. Nijalingappa Medical College and Hanagal Shree Kumareshwar Hospital and Research Centre (SNMC) is a premier medical institution in Bagalkot, Karnataka. Established in 2002, the college is named after the late Sri S. Nijalingappa, former CM of Karnataka. It offers high-quality medical education and healthcare services to the North Karnataka region.Top Recruiters & Placements

Frequently Asked Questions
Is SNMC Bagalkot a government or private college?
It is a private medical college managed by the B.V.V. Sangha.
What is the intake for MBBS for the current session?
The annual intake capacity for the MBBS course is 250 students.
